1. Cool it Down:
Cast iron doesn’t like surprises, especially of the temperature variety. Leave your hot pot to cool down completely before you clean it.
2. Wash it Up:
Clean your pot after every use. The best way to clean your Dutch oven is with warm water, a gentle liquid dishwashing soap and a soft sponge or brush, for example made from silicone or nylon. Your Dutch oven is also dishwasher friendly if you’d prefer.
3. Don’t Scratch It:
Avoid using steel wool or other abrasive cleaning products on your Dutch oven as they may damage the enamel coating of your cookware.
4. Don’t Soak It Overnight:
Best not to soak your Dutch oven for long periods of time (i.e overnight). If food has stuck to the base of the pot or stained the exterior, make a paste using a teaspoon of baking soda and a splash of white vinegar. Rub in the paste with a soft cloth or sponge and repeat as required.
5. Dry Me Please:
Use a towel to hand-dry your Dutch Oven and lid before storage, to prevent water marks or rust formation.
6. Be Nice: Cast iron cookware is designed to be very tough and sturdy, but do be kind and try not to drop or knock your Dutch oven.

Although enamelled cast iron is dishwasher safe, hand washing with warm soapy water and a nylon scrub brush is recommended to preserve the cookware's original appearance.
If using a dishwasher, we recommend not placing the Dutch Oven on the bottom shelf.
Citrus juices and citrus-based cleaners (including some dishwasher detergents) should be avoided, as they can dull the exterior gloss.
